Indian Men’s Hockey Team Meets BJD President Naveen Patnaik After Historic Bronze at Paris Olympics 2024

Bhubaneswar: The Indian Men’s Hockey Team, fresh off their historic bronze medal win at the Paris Olympics 2024, met with BJD President Naveen Patnaik at his residence in Bhubaneswar today. The team was warmly felicitated by the BJD supremo for their remarkable achievement on the global stage.

Expressing his delight, Patnaik said, “It was an immense pleasure meeting the victorious Indian Hockey Team after their coveted bronze medal win at the Paris Olympics. Hockey is not just a sport; it is a way of life in Odisha. We always share a special bond with this beautiful game.”

The Chief Minister, who has been a long-time supporter of Indian hockey, further emphasized the state’s deep connection with the sport and wished the team continued success. “May the team continue its winning momentum and bring more glory for the nation and the state,” Patnaik added.

Odisha has been at the forefront of supporting Indian hockey, hosting international tournaments and providing state-of-the-art facilities for training and development. The team’s bronze medal in Paris marks a significant milestone in India’s hockey resurgence, and the state has played a pivotal role in this journey.
